Emotional Support: Combat Loneliness with 24-Hour Care
Loneliness is a significant issue for many elderly individuals, impacting their emotional and mental well-being. This isolation can lead to serious health concerns, making it crucial to address the emotional needs of older adults.
One effective solution is hiring a 24 hour carer. These caregivers provide ongoing companionship, engaging clients in meaningful conversations and enjoyable activities. This interaction fosters social connections that are vital for enhancing mental health.
Research indicates that regular interactions with caregivers can reduce feelings of isolation, elevate mood, and even improve cognitive function. By ensuring that older adults feel valued and connected, a 24-hour carer plays a crucial role in their overall happiness and stability.
In summary, the presence of a caregiver not only enhances the quality of life for older adults but also leads to better health outcomes, making it an essential component of emotional support.

Daily Living Assistance: Ensure Safety and Comfort Around the Clock
Problem: Many seniors struggle with daily living tasks, which can lead to safety concerns and emotional distress for both them and their families.
Agitate: Without proper support, seniors may face challenges in bathing, dressing, meal preparation, and medication management. This lack of assistance not only increases the risk of accidents but also diminishes their independence and quality of life. Families often worry about their loved ones' safety, which can lead to stress and anxiety.
The solution is that 24 hour carers play a vital role in providing essential daily living support. With a 24 hour carer providing assistance, families can feel reassured knowing their loved ones are safe and well-looked after. Ongoing support leads to better safety outcomes, as trained aides implement customized safety measures tailored to the needs of elderly clients. These measures include:
- Fall prevention strategies
- Medication reminders
- Emergency response protocols
The presence of a committed support provider not only enhances physical safety but also promotes emotional well-being, allowing older adults to maintain their independence while feeling supported in their daily routines.

Post-Hospital Recovery: Smooth Transitions with 24-Hour Care
After a hospital stay, many elderly individuals face a significant challenge: the need for extra assistance to ensure a smooth recovery. This situation can lead to complications, increased stress for caregivers, and even the risk of readmissions. Without proper support, seniors may struggle to regain their independence, often feeling overwhelmed in unfamiliar environments.
To address this issue, 24 hour carers can play a crucial role. They provide essential services such as:
- Medication management
- Mobility support
- Monitoring for any complications
This ongoing support from a 24 hour carer not only helps prevent readmissions but also promotes a quicker recovery, allowing seniors to regain their independence in the comfort of their own homes.

Flexible Scheduling: Tailor Care to Fit Your Family's Needs
One of the significant challenges caregivers face is balancing their work and caregiving duties. Research indicates that nearly 48 million Americans assist an adult family member, with two-thirds of these caregivers reporting difficulties in managing both responsibilities. This situation highlights the pressing need for adaptable scheduling and customized support plans that can alleviate some of this burden.
Flexible scheduling is a key solution. Hiring a 24 hour carer enables families to customize support plans to meet their unique needs, whether that involves adjusting hours according to family obligations or offering assistance during particular times of day. This adaptability ensures that seniors receive the necessary support when they need it most, ultimately enhancing their comfort and quality of life.
Moreover, statistics reveal that 45% of employed caregivers have access to flexible work schedules, with 80% of them utilizing this option. This underscores the importance of adaptability in caregiving, allowing caregivers to manage their responsibilities more effectively.

Companionship: Foster Social Engagement with 24-Hour Care
Companionship is a significant issue in providing 24 hour carer services, as many older adults experience feelings of isolation. This lack of social interaction can lead to serious mental health challenges, including depression and anxiety. In fact, studies show that one in three older adults report feeling lonely, which can negatively impact their overall quality of life. Persistent isolation can even reduce life expectancy more than being overweight or inactive, underscoring the urgent need to address loneliness among this population.
Psychologists emphasize that supportive relationships are vital for older adults. Those with strong social connections are less likely to face mental health issues. Caregivers play a crucial role in fostering these connections, providing emotional support that helps elderly individuals feel valued and understood. Engaging clients in social activities not only combats loneliness but also promotes healthier lifestyle choices, leading to improved physical and emotional health.
Activities like:
- Playing games
- Participating in arts and crafts
- Simply sharing stories
can greatly enrich a senior's life. By prioritizing companionship in caregiving, families can engage a 24 hour carer to help their loved ones maintain a sense of purpose and joy, ultimately enhancing their quality of life. Initiatives such as the AARP Foundation's Connect2Affect aim to tackle social isolation and loneliness among older individuals, highlighting the growing need for companion support services.

Technology Integration: Enhance Care Management with 24-Hour Support
The integration of technology into 24 hour carer services addresses a significant problem: the challenges of care management and communication. 24 hour carers often struggle to provide efficient support, which can affect the well-being of seniors. This issue not only affects the quality of care provided by a 24 hour carer but also threatens the independence of those who rely on it.
To illustrate, tools such as health monitoring devices - including blood pressure cuffs, glucose monitors, and pulse oximeters - along with medication reminders and digital communication platforms, empower caregivers to enhance their support. For instance, remote health monitoring kits allow for daily sharing of health data with healthcare providers and family members. This facilitates early detection of health changes, reducing unnecessary clinic visits and ensuring timely interventions.
Families benefit from real-time updates on their loved ones' health, promoting a collaborative approach to caregiving that includes a 24 hour carer, enhancing both safety and quality of life. As Robert F. Kennedy, Jr., HHS Secretary, noted, "AI can revolutionize caregiving by providing immediate assistance, anticipating health risks before they occur, overseeing well-being, and streamlining documentation so that those providing care can concentrate on what is most important - the care and compassion for the individuals they aim to assist."
Additionally, falls pose a significant risk for seniors, making the use of fall detection wearables a crucial solution for enhancing safety. Family caregivers are encouraged to explore these technologies to improve their caregiving practices and ensure their loved ones receive the best possible support.
